2

countif函数的使用方法(countif函数的用法)

  嘿!大家好,我是一位资深的操作系统优化师,今天给大家分享一下如何使用countif函数来进行计数。

  嘿!大家好,我是一位资深的操作系统优化师,今天给大家分享一下如何使用countif函数来进行计数。

  首先,我们来看看如何统计各种类型的单元格个数。如果想要统计真空单元格个数,可以使用COUNTIF(数据区,=)这样的公式。同理,要统计非真空单元格个数,可以用COUNTIF(数据区,<>),这其实相当于counta()函数了。如果想要统计文本型单元格个数,可以用COUNTIF(数据区,*),要注意的是,假空单元格也被视为文本型单元格。如果想要统计区域内所有单元格的个数,可以用COUNTIF(数据区,<>),但如果数据区内有空格,这个公式可能就不适用了。最后,如果想要统计逻辑值为TRUE的单元格数量,可以使用COUNTIF(数据区,TRUE)。

  接下来是如何求大于或小于某个值的单元格个数。要求大于50的单元格个数,可以使用COUNTIF(数据区,>50);如果要统计等于50的单元格个数,可以用COUNTIF(数据区,50);而小于50的单元格个数,可以使用COUNTIF(数据区,<50)。类似地,大于或等于50的单元格个数可以用COUNTIF(数据区,>=50),小于或等于50的单元格个数则可以用COUNTIF(数据区,<=50)。如果想要求大于某个特定单元格E5的值的单元格个数,可以使用COUNTIF(数据区,>&$E$5),而等于E5单元格值的单元格个数可以用COUNTIF(数据区,$E$5),小于E5单元格值的单元格个数则可以用COUNTIF(数据区,<&$E$5)。同样地,大于或等于E5单元格值的单元格个数可以用COUNTIF(数据区,>=&$E$5),小于或等于E5的单元格个数则可以用COUNTIF(数据区,<=&$E$5)。

  接下来是如何统计等于或包含某N个特定字符的单元格个数。如果要统计两个字符的个数,可以使用COUNTIF(数据区,??);如果要统计两个字符并且第二个字符是B的个数,可以用COUNTIF(数据区,?B);如果想要统计包含字母B的单元格个数,可以使用COUNTIF(数据区,*B*);而第二个字符是B的单元格个数可以用COUNTIF(数据区,?B*)。如果要统计等于“你好”的单元格个数,则可以使用COUNTIF(数据区,你好)。另外,如果要统计包含与D3单元格内容相同的单元格个数,可以使用COUNTIF(数据区,*&D3&*);而第二个字符与D3单元格内容相同的单元格个数可以用COUNTIF(数据区,?&D3&*)。

  对于countif()函数,不区分英文字母的大小写,并且通配符只对文本有效。

  如果我们想要使用两个条件来计数,可以使用SUM(COUNTIF(数据区,>&{10,15})*{1,-1})这样的公式。例如,要计算大于10并且小于等于15的单元格个数,可以这样操作。类似地,要计算大于等于10并且小于15的单元格个数,可以用SUM(COUNTIF(数据区,>=&{10,15})*{1,-1});要计算大于等于10并且小于等于15的单元格个数,可以使用SUM(COUNTIF(数据区,{>=10,>15})*{1,-1});而大于10并且小于等于15的单元格个数可以用SUM(COUNTIF(数据区,{>10,>=15})*{1,-1})或者SUM(COUNTIF(数据区,{>10,>=15})-样本数)。

  需要注意的是,一般情况下,我们更常用SUMPRODUCT函数来完成多条件计数,少用以上的方法。不过这些方法也可以供大家参考。

  最后,如果我们想要计算三个区域中大于等于60的单元格个数,可以使用SUM(COUNTIF(INDIRECT({a46:a48,b48:b50,c47:c48}),>=60))。

  另外,我们还可以利用集合运算法来进行范围的统计。比如,想要统计满足5<= x <=7的单元格个数,可以将它分解成(x>=5)-(x>7)。这样,我们可以使用函数=countif(range,>=5)-countif(range,>7)来实现。这种方法更加简单易于理解。

本文来自网络,不代表本站立场。转载请注明出处: https://tj.jiuquan.cc/a-2511350/
1
上一篇解压缩文件下载(手机好用的免费压缩文件软件实用的文件压缩软件推荐)
下一篇 硬盘的型号(如何查看笔记本电脑的固态硬盘型号)

为您推荐

联系我们

联系我们

在线咨询: QQ交谈

邮箱: alzn66@foxmail.com

关注微信

微信扫一扫关注我们

返回顶部